Candlewood Suites Williamsport
3.7/545 Reviews
This is definitely an older hotel in need of updating and, although the important areas were clean, needs a thorough cleaning in less obvious spaces. For example, the bathroom vanity and toilet were clean, but the built-in hair dryer was dusty. The kitchen area was clean, but the sconces on the wall were covered in dust. The bed was clean and comfy, but the carpet was stained. The dishwasher had a ”cleaned” sticker on it, but upon opening, half the dishes needed to be hand washed because there was residue. Almost all the dishes in the room were in the dishwasher. There were dirt smudges on the doors and curtains. The room was very very damp the entire time (5 days and it rained twice). Despite being on the ground floor near the parking lot, it was very quiet. However, one night we came back to our room to fire trucks - someone had spilled gasoline in the hallway (!?) and they were trying to air out the area. The next night the fire alarm went off (someone's cooking). The front desk had some of the worst service I've ever experienced in a hotel. Every time you needed something (which was often - only one serving of coffee for a 5 night stay, one roll of toilet paper, needed to exchange old towels for clean ones) the staff acted as if you were bothering them. When I asked for pool towels, the woman behind the desk said ”only if you come up to the closet with me and get them.” She had to come back down (closet on third floor) and past the office to get to the pool, so why did I need to come with her? Pool was dirty, so we only spent about 5 minutes in it anyway. Despite all this, the hotel is very conveniently located to chain restaurants and stores and a very short drive to Little League facilities and downtown. Having a kitchenette was very convenient. The room itself as well as the bathroom and closet were big.

Motel 6 Montoursville, PA
3.2/5103 Reviews
I'm obsessed with hiking waterfall trails and several google searches revealed quite a few waterfalls in the Loyalsock Forest/World's End State Park area so I booked a room at this Motel 6 because it seemed pretty central to the area I wanted to explore. Check in was seamless, however after entering our room I quickly realized that housekeeping seemed, for the most part, to have paid little, if any, attention to our room. The nightstand between the 2 beds was obviously not even wiped down judging by the multitude of visible fingerprints; there was not only no toilet paper in the bathroom but no soap, cups or other complimentary toiletries. In light of the current situation we find ourselves in I had no problem wiping down the furniture in our room because I would have automatically done so anyway but after notifying the front desk the manager took care of everything immediately and apologized saying that they had some new hires that clearly needed more training. The room was fairly spacious, more than enough room for hubby, myself and our golden retriever but the beds were a little too firm for my liking but not uncomfortable. Flat screen TV with a large channel selection and excellent wifi, power strip for your phone chargers and the air conditioner kept our room nice and cool plus our room was super quiet but I wasn't a fan of the motion activated light switch in the bathroom (especially when getting up in the middle of the night and trying not to disturb hubby). We were on the first floor and right outside the exit there was small wooded area for our dog to use the bathroom. Right down the road there was even a nice walking trail along the Susquehanna River/railroad tracks, we saw lots of snails on our morning hike (never seen anything like that before). The owners clearly live on site and were always available for whatever we needed. I would definitely stay at this hotel when in the area again. This hotel was right off the expressway and only minutes from local parks and attractions and there were plenty of restaurants nearby. Parking lot was well lit and well maintained and not sure if it is available for the guests to use but there was a grill and picnic table near the small wooded area just outside the side exit.
